What age are classes suitable for?

Messy/ Sensory Play: Suitable from 6 months to 5 years. In the week day classes during term time the average age would be from 6 months - 2/3 years as older children are generally in ECCE or school. At weekends and in school holidays we see a wider variety of ages.

Role Play Village: Our suggested stage in development is from walking to 6 years. Babies are welcome to also attend free of charge, there is no need to book in.

How long is each session?

Messy play & Role Play Village: Each session is 1 hour long, as there is formal teaching you can arrive and leave whenever suits you. We focus on child-led play.

How many children are in each class?

Messy play: The maximum number of children is between 15 - 20 it varies due to location and depends on the room size.

Role Play Village: The maximum number of children is 25 children per session, there are 10 destinations to explore. We have a large room with lots of space to take our car or trolley for a spin!

How is the room set up?

Messy Play: There are 8 stations in total 6 messy, a sensory station and a further 2 areas which rotate weekly. Each week there is a new theme, learning resources and mess to explore. The sessions are a child-led experience which allow our adventurers play within their interests.

Role Play Village: We have 10 destinations in the village, come and explore our construction area, hairdressers, post office, cafe, supermarket, garden, emergency room, vet, home or theatre.

What do I need to bring or wear?

Messy play: Both children and parents will get messy so don’t wear your best clothes. Please bring a change of clothes, wet wipes and a towel.
